云计算是近年来新兴的一种计算机技术,其配置快速以及可提供根据用户需求而动态伸缩的服务。这些特点使得其越来越受到人们的青睐。可以预见的是在不久的将来,云计算将会把计算资源逐步改造并普及为像自来水一样触手可及的公共资源,而这意味着计算规模以及计算速度将会出现质与量上的双重突破。79340
随着云计算的商业化规模不断扩大,越来越多的云服务提供商涌现于市场。然而商人的逐利性迫使他们急需一个在最小化其运维成本的情况下可以解决用户需求不稳定性的处理方案。在这种情况下,云联邦应运而生。云服务提供商可以通过云间协作来提高自己的计算资源利用率,进而提高他们的服务能力以及用户负载容量。因此,现在云计算技术的发展的方向不再是仅仅基于一个的单一云系统而去考虑,更是需要考虑由多个云提供商组成的云联邦为基础的协作型计算环境。
云计算的出现对于数据安全防护提出了挑战,尤其是私人数据在单个云和云联邦中所面临的挑战尤为严峻,然而在现有的法律中只对云提供商的服务外包做出了限制。因此,文献中提出了一系列基于云架构的定义并制定了其他的相关云资源使用规则,在这之中也包含了根据不同级别(任务规格级别或者是需求级别如安全性等)而对云服务商进行自动选择的限制,以及发起数据外包的过程中所需的法律信息。上述规则与限制可以在机器理解的方式下自动的进行严格的获取与检查。此外,在云联邦中,尽可能的使得个体的利益最大化与使联邦整体利益的最大化在重要性上是处于同等地位的。正如云提供商可以为用户解决突发性的负载均衡问题,云联邦也将会在云个体出现资源紧张问题时,为其填补计算资源缺口而提供帮助与解决方案,这种响应与处理机制也是使得单个云服务商之间进行互利协作并最终组成云联邦的利益基础。 论文网
在云联邦环境下,资源分配可以依靠第三方代理的方式进行协调调度,也可以在代理不参与的情况下进行资源的调度与分配。正如所得出的研究结果所示,他们提出一种可以动态的改变系统配置的设计方案。它不仅能够在特定的时间节点将计算资源分配给一个指定的云联邦成员,也能够利用虚拟化和非虚拟化的资源之间的映射来提供一种可以根据用户的需求而动态的进行调整的伸缩性资源管理框架。他们的网格在实际用户操作过程中所收集其使用数据,并通过利用网格的统计结果来为该管理框架提供支持。这是未使用第三方代理时的一种改进方案。除此之外,云提供商资源需求缺口问题也可以通过譬如Nancy在文献中构建的经济模型来解决。该模型是一个在混合云环境中工作的协同优化模型。在该经济模型中每一个云提供商都是自私的,其自身的逐利性要求其将自己的个体利益最大化,他们在通过将闲置的资源出租给其他云提供商以获取更多的利益与为应对未来可能到来的资源需求高峰而预留资源之间进行反复博弈。它采用了严格的触发策略的P2P的供应策略,但这也是一种第三方代理没有参与其中的资源管理方式。
除此之外,Nivato以及其所带领的团队研究了多个云提供商间进行的的合作的实例并构建出一个分层合作博弈模型。其研究重点在于基于一组云服务提供商各自所拥有的资源及其资源需求,共同构建一个资源池(即将资源虚拟化为一个逻辑上的集合)。他们的目标是是设计出一个可以在内部用户需求实时变化的情况下仍然可用的随机线性博弈模型。在该模型之中,各个云供应商在协作的前提之下各自设计自己的的随机线性策略。云提供商的信息与资源共享使联盟成员与彼此之间产生大量的交互,并在各个云提供商可以以合作处理事务和进行资源调度的前提下最终使得云联邦的结构更加稳定。这种分层合作博弈模型可以在云供应商同意协作的情况下用来制定更为高效的解决方案。 云计算环境下的资源分配算法研究现状:http://www.youerw.com/yanjiu/lunwen_91653.html